#5e4300 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#5e4300 is composed of 36.9% red, 26.3%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 28.7% magenta, 100% yellow and 63.1% black. It has a hue angle of 42.8 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 18.4%. #5e4300 color hex could be obtained by blending #bc8600 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

● #5e4300 color description : Very dark orange [Brown tone].
#5e4300 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#5e4300 has RGB values of R:94, G:67,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.29, Y:1, K:0.63. Its decimal value is 6177536.

Shades and Tints of #5e4300
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#100b00 is the darkest color, while #fffefb is the lightest one.
